Story summary
  • Real estate agent Alex Hall described Los Angeles as a "third world country" during a podcast with Jason Oppenheim, citing crime and homelessness.
  • Jason Oppenheim attributed California's loss of a million residents since the COVID-19 pandemic to restrictive policies and tax increases, including the 2023 mansion tax.
  • Despite a 4% drop in homelessness in July, the issue remains severe, and listeners resonated with the discussion about Los Angeles's deteriorating conditions.
